[In preview] Public Preview: MAI-Transcribe-1.5 in Microsoft Foundry model catalog
What the source says
Microsoft Foundry adds MAI-Transcribe-1.5 to the model catalog in public preview, Microsoft's next-generation speech-to-text model. The release adds improved accuracy with noticeably lower word error rate on long-tail locales than the previous generation, plus faster real-time and batch transcription with predictable latency. Target workloads include call center analytics, media captioning, voice agent transcription, and meeting recording. MAI-Transcribe-1.5 is available via Global Standard deployments with Foundry-native governance, regional support, and content safety controls shared across MAI models.
